Yoichi whiskies are crafted making use of classic techniques, such as the utilization of immediate coal-fired pot stills, which impart a distinctive smoky and sturdy character into the spirit.

The output process of Japanese whisky includes a mix of traditional Scottish distilling approaches and unique Japanese tactics. The barley is imported from Scotland and malted in Japan, then distilled and aged in many different different barrels, including Japanese oak, Japanese Whiskey Shot bourbon casks, and sherry butts.

Blends that incorporate whisky imported from other nations, like Suntory Ao, are known as a environment whisky. “Entire world blends were being made mainly because, not like Scotland, Japanese distilleries don’t function alongside one another to generate blends,” suggests Pollachi. “Consequently, the initial malt distilleries in Japan relied on other environment whiskies for Mixing—exclusively Scotland as the grain, the stills and the complete course of action Employed in Japan was a carbon copy of Scottish malt distilling in any case.
